Nestled within one of the mountain regions of Rutan was a complex structure. It was built with the intention of blending with the terrain save for a small hanger where two freighters could safely dock. One spot was clearly occupied by a peculiar Z-95, and old relic as many would say. Yet somehow was in working condition with some modifications to it. Occupying these hangers and throughout the laboratory were humanoids don in a plain red robe. Their mouths were visibly stitched shut as their eyes lacked the usual spark of life as people tended to have. The will to life, the will of their own. All of it had been robbed, leaving an empty husks of their former selves as they mindlessly obeyed the one person that commanded them, and the one who had stolen their will.
At the heart of this laboratory was a well lit room with a workbench on one side filled with tools and components for medical purposes. Whether it was for fabricating toxins or medicines, Aloth made sure to both keep her guests entertained and stray them away from death. No matter how close or how much they wanted death to be away from their torment. Lined along the northern walls were bacta tanks filled with the bacta water. Some of them were occupied by humans, all were unconscious. There were several strange baubles and beakers filled with various liquids as they traveled from one container to the next.
Strapped to a lone table in the center was a human female garbed in tattered robes. The brunette had short hair save for a lone braid that trailed past her ear, and although she was young there was much fear in her eyes.
"Just let me go! You know once the Jedi Order finds out that I'm missing they will find you, and there is nowhere for you to go," she said as her hazel eyes were as wide as saucer disks. Aloth chuckled at the threat as she delicately lifted a peculiar vial filled with a thick black liquid before she stuck a syringe through it.
"Perhaps they will, and perhaps they will find that their precious little Padawan is no longer… well, sane. Besides, there's something that I will need your help with. You're the only one around here who can do so," the Chiss said as the black liquid slowly filled the syringe. It was only a hundred milliliters, and the syringe itself was relatively small at that. Fear was mixed with confusion on the young girl's face as she tried to look over to the Sith Knight. The restraints on her head, wrists, and knees made it difficult to move or muster the strength to do so.
There were only three doors, and each were flanked by a pair of mindless red robed figures. Sometimes, the Padawan could've sworn she heard one of them mumble something, but it was hard to hear if it was even comprehensible.
"What do you mean?" The Padawan was hesitant to ask, but she braved through her own fear to figure out what it was that Aloth wanted her for.
"As fate would have it, you're the only one to survive this upcoming trial. Just take a deep breath, calm your emotions, and endure." Aloth turned on her heel to face the restrained Jedi with the syringe in hand before she menacingly approached them. Despite what Aloth loathed about the Jedi, her visions had shown this particular girl to be resilient to this toxin. Fabricated from Sith Alchemy, Aloth wanted to test to see how lethal this poison was, but she was also curious as to see if the body could resist the poison and ultimately adjust to it.
Despite her advice, the Padawan's fear continued to grow as desperation to fight against her restraints increased tenfold. Aloth continued to approach at her leisure as she allowed the fear to fester in the young one's mind. Suddenly the Padawan's left arm was seized by a vice grip of Aloth's as she could see the veins. The thin needle punctured the Padawan's skin, and just as Aloth injected the toxin into the victim. She was shown another vision by the Force. Another presence, one who was more experienced and wielded a lightsaber. Yet unlike the typical Jedi, this one felt more torn. A vision of such an individual coming to her was shown, and with it Aloth felt a presence in the Force that was flying near the facility.
She turned to her henchmen after she took the needle out and wiped off the spot that was punctured with a disinfectant wipe.
"We shall have some company soon. See to it that they're… entertained, while I finish this up." The mindless husks did not speak, but they each grabbed a peculiar pike that produced electricity on both ends. As the robed slaves ventured towards the hanger as it was the only entrance and exit out of this place. The Padawan was hyperventilating as she was expecting burns, pain of untold measure, something that would attempt to break her down. Her mind was running wild in fear as the expected never came to her. Aloth smiled coyly.
"Oh dear, you honestly thought it would take immediate effect? Well, don't you worry. You'll feel it soon enough." So Aloth sat down on her chair with her chin propped by one hand. The other was simply twirling a single cylindrical hilt that many would recognize to be a lightsaber. It wasn't Aloth's, as she wasn't fond of the bright colors. But if there really was a Jedi coming here. Then Aloth had a mind to toy with them as a mockery of the Jedi Order and their beliefs. All the while her lightsaber remained strapped at her side by the belt. It was definitely longer than the one Aloth was holding, and instead of one blade emitter her lightsaber possessed two blade emitters.
